 3x + 4y = 5
<u>-5x - 4y = -11</u>
       -2x = -6
       -<u>2x</u> = <u>-6</u>
        -2     -2
          x = 3
3(3) + 4y = 5
    9 + 4y = 5
<u>   -9          -9</u>
         4y = -4
         <u>4y</u> = <u>-4</u>
          4      4
           y = -1
     (x, y) = (3, -1)
